The Greens at Salvatora Farms: Course Intelligence
The Vibe & Terrain
Nestled in the picturesque landscapes of Pennsylvania, The Greens at Salvatora Farms offers a delightful parkland golf experience characterized by rolling hills, lush tree lines, and strategically placed water hazards. This course is a true hidden gem that balances challenge with playability, making it suitable for golfers of all skill levels. You’ll find yourself immersed in a serene atmosphere, where the beauty of nature meets the thrill of the game. The layout encourages thoughtful strategy and precision, with each hole presenting its unique character, whether it’s a dogleg or a straightaway.
Local "Insider" Tips
- Watch the Breaks: Greens in this area tend to break towards the nearby creek, so keep that in mind when lining up your putts.
- Afternoon Breezes: Be prepared for afternoon winds that can shift your ball flight, especially on the back nine.
- Play Smart: Avoid the temptation to go for every pin; sometimes, a conservative shot will set you up for an easier par.

⛳ Difficulty & Signature Features
The Greens at Salvatora Farms presents a challenging yet rewarding experience for golfers. The course features a mix of tight fairways and strategically placed water hazards, which contribute to its difficulty. Golfers can expect a layout that tests both strategy and skill.
For those interested in the Greens at Salvatora Farms difficulty, the scorecard suggests a solid challenge that appeals to mid to low handicap players.
🤔 Is It Worth Playing?
Final Verdict: Play here if you enjoy a well-designed course that offers a solid challenge and scenic views. However, skip if you prefer a more forgiving layout, as beginners may find the course punishing.
